>> Ook wrote:
>>> Alfred, I would be very surprised indeed if Valve was not aware
>>> that several of use are running hl1mp source *dedicated* servers,
>>> and not from the in-game UI (you did know this, didn't you????).
>>> It's not that difficult - first you use hldsupdatetool to install
>>> hl2mp. Anyone can do this, you don't even need a steam account.
>>> Then you do as I've outlined below and copy the stuff from the GCF
>>> files I've listed. One can only do this if they actually own the
>>> game. Then you start the server:
>>>
>>> srcds -game hl1mp
>>>
>>> I've been doing this for a while now, as have others. It works very
>>> well. We do this because the hldsupdatetool does not support hl1mp,
>>> and who here actually uses the in-steam dedicated server? Also,
>>> using the listen server option from the game itself is extremely
>>> unreliable.
